[edit] Explanation
String theory hypothesizes that there are many more than 3 dimensions, it's just that we can't see the rest because they're "rolled up." A common metaphor is an ant on a tightrope — it has two degrees of freedom, one along the rope and one around it, but from far away we can only see one.
So Black Hat released his 2D movie about string theory in "3D", and claimed that the third dimension was there — just too small to see.
